Joule : Joule is a derived unit of energy, work, or amount of heat in the international system of units. Its symbol is J. In the energy unit system, it is equal to the energy expended in applying a force of one newton through a distance of one meter. The unit name “joule” is in honor of the English physicist James Prescott Joule. How many joule in 1 N-m? The answer is 1.
Newton-meter. Definition: The newton-meter (N·m) is sometimes used as a unit of work or energy and in this context is equal to the joule, the SI unit of energy. The SI derived unit for energy is the joule.

One joule converted into newton meter equals = 1.00 N-m 1 J = 1.00 N-… 1 joule is equal to (approximately unless otherwise stated): 1 × 10 7 erg (exactly) 6.241 509 74 × 10 18 eV; 0.2390 cal (gram calories) 2.390 × 10 −4 kcal (food calories) 9.4782 × 10 −4 BTU; 0.7376 ft⋅lb (foot-pound) 23.7 ft⋅pdl (foot-poundal) 2.7778 × 10 −7 kW⋅h (kilowatt-hour) 2.7778 × 10 −4 W⋅h (watt-hour) 9.8692 × 10 −3 l⋅atm (litre-atmosphere) Joule is a derived unit of energy and it is named in honor of James Prescott Joule and his experiments on the mechanical equivalent of heat. In more fundamental terms, 1 joule is equal to: 1 J = 1 kg.m2/s2 The joule symbol J, is a derived unit of energy in the International System of Units. It is equal to the energy transferred to (or work done on) an object when a force of one newton acts on that object in the direction of its motion through a distance of one metre (1 newton metre or N.m).
